No screening appointments for 100,000 primary school children last year, say dentists

RTE 25 Apr 2024
It said that despite 208,233 children being eligible for the scheme, only 104,488 were assessed by a public dentist ... The IDA says the problem is down to a shortage of public dentists, with a 23% fall in public dentist numbers between 2006-2022.
